溯恩概要写作公开课
1.概要写作注意事项:
1.
通读(5-6分钟)—定主题和文章结构
2.
在还不是很紧张的情况下列备用词(1-2分钟)
3.
每段细读:找每段的主题句和关键信息(注意高频词和信号词)5-10分钟
4.
用自己语言描述:共10-15分钟
5.
合并通读:字数、连接、语法、拼写
3分钟
二.概要写作(浙江省省级重点中学平时练习的)
Three
hundred
years
ago,
people
had
much
shorter
lives
than
we
have
nowadays.
In
the
old
days,
if
people
survived
to
be
an
adult,
they
often
lived
to
60
or
70.
At
present,
the
average
life
people
can
live
is
66
years.
In
some
countries,
such
as
Japan
and
France,
it
is
more
than
80
years.
The
main
reason
for
this
is
better
diet,
better
hygiene
(卫生)
and
better
health
care.
It
was
much
more
dangerous
to
have
children
in
those
days.
Nine
percent
of
women
died
when
having
children.
Even
worse,
women
had
more
children
than
women
do
today.
For
example,
in
1800,
the
average
American
family
had
7
children.
However,
the
average
American
family
has
less
than
2
children
now.?
People
in
those
days
knew
much
less
about
hygiene
than
we
do.
Many
people
thought
it
was
dangerous
to
take
a
bath.
They
often
bathed
only
once
or
twice
a
year.
Instead
they
used
perfume
to
cover
their
body
odor
(气味).
Poor
people
didn't
have
enough
money
to
buy
toilets
or
clean
water.
Toothpaste
wasn't
available
in
those
days,
either.
Only
rich
people
used
toothbrushes,
so
toothache
was
very
common.
There
was
no
dentist
until
the
middle
of
the
19th
century.
If
people
had
a
toothache,
they
had
to
go
to
the
barber.
A
barber
at
that
time
not
only
cut
hair
but
also
took
out
teeth
and
did
other
small
operations.
The
way
doctors
treated
illnesses
in
the
past
is
rather
strange
to
us.
In
the
l8th
century.
Doctors
treated
almost
any
disease
in
the
same
way.
They
removed
blood
from
the
patients
and
often
used
leeches
(水蛭,蚂蟥)
to
help
them.
Hospitals
were
also
dangerous
places.
By
the
end
of
the
19th
century,
more
than
half
of
the
patients
had
died
from
the
diseases
which
came
from
other
patients.
